Three concrete AI opportunities with ROI framing

1. Predictive Fall Prevention (High Impact) Falls are the leading cause of injury and loss of independence among seniors, costing a typical CCRC millions annually in litigation and increased care needs. By deploying computer vision sensors (with edge processing for privacy) in high-risk skilled nursing corridors, Moravian Manor can detect gait changes or unsafe bed exits in real time. A 20% reduction in falls with injury could save over $150,000 annually in direct costs, while preserving resident trust and census.

2. AI-Driven Staffing Optimization (High Impact) Agency staffing costs have skyrocketed post-pandemic. An AI scheduler that forecasts census and acuity 14 days out can reduce last-minute agency fill-ins by 30%. For a community spending $2M+ on contract labor, this represents a $600,000 annual savings. The same tool improves employee satisfaction by preventing burnout-driven turnover, a hidden cost multiplier.

3. 30-Day Readmission Risk Engine (High Impact) Value-based care contracts and Medicare penalties make hospital readmissions a financial drain. An AI model trained on the community’s EHR data can flag a returning resident with a high risk of decompensation, triggering a bundled intervention (e.g., daily pharmacist review, increased vitals monitoring). Reducing readmissions by just 10% can strengthen payer negotiations and improve CMS star ratings.

Deployment risks specific to this size band

A 201-500 employee organization lacks a dedicated data science team, making vendor selection critical. The primary risk is adopting a “black box” solution that staff distrust. Mitigation requires choosing explainable AI and running a 90-day pilot in one unit with a clinician champion. A second risk is data fragmentation; the community likely uses separate systems for HR, EHR, and dining. A lightweight integration layer or a vendor with pre-built connectors is essential to avoid a failed implementation. Finally, resident and family privacy concerns must be front and center—opt for technologies that analyze patterns, not record identities, to maintain the community’s trusted, homelike atmosphere.

What is the biggest AI quick-win for a CCRC like Moravian Manor?
AI-powered fall prevention using existing Wi-Fi or sensors. It directly reduces the top cost driver—injury-related hospitalizations—and can be piloted in a single skilled nursing wing.
How can AI help with the chronic staffing shortage in senior care?
AI scheduling tools match shift demand to resident acuity, reducing burnout. Ambient documentation saves each nurse up to 2 hours per shift on paperwork.
Is our resident data sufficient to start an AI project?
Yes. Your EHR (likely PointClickCare or MatrixCare) holds years of structured data on falls, meds, and vitals—enough to train a readmission or fall-risk model.
What are the privacy risks of using AI with senior residents?
HIPAA compliance is paramount. Opt for edge-based processing where video is analyzed locally and only alerts are sent, never raw footage, to protect dignity.
Can AI help us compete with newer, for-profit senior living operators?
Absolutely. AI enables data-driven proof of better outcomes (lower falls, fewer readmissions), which is a powerful differentiator for families and referral partners.
How do we fund AI initiatives as a non-profit community?
Start with grants for aging-in-place technology. Many AI vendors offer SaaS models, and the ROI from reduced agency staffing costs can fund expansion within 12-18 months.
Will AI replace our caregivers?
No. AI handles predictive insights and paperwork, allowing caregivers to focus on the human connection and complex care decisions that only they can provide.
